Irradiation of 2,5,7,7-tetraphenyl-7-boratabicyclo<4.1.0>hepta-2,4-diene anion (1, a boratanorcaradiene, as its potassium or tetramethylammonium salt) with UV light leads to formation of p-terphenyl in high yield.This observation led us to consider the possibility that diphenylborene anion (Ph2B-, an analogue of diphenylcarbene) might also be formed in this reaction.We designed and carried out a series of spectroscopic and chemical experiments to detect and characterize the borene.None of these experiments provides evidence for the formation of diphenylborene from this reaction.We suggest that the formation of p-terphenyl from the photolysis of 1 is initiated by an electron-transfer (photoionization) process.We also reexamined experiments reported earlier that were claimed to show that diphenylborene is formed from the irraditation or overirradiation of tetraphenylborate.Each of these experiments is ambiguous and cannot be relied upon to demonstrate the formation of the borene by this route.
